2). B.Com. with Major in Corporate Affairs and Administration: B.Com. (CA&A)
Exclusively for the ICSI students only
Bachelor of Commerce with Major in Corporate Affairs and Administration is designed and developed
in collaboration with the Institute of Company Secretaries of India, exclusively for the Company
Secretaryship students.
Minimum Duration: 3 Years; Maximum Duration: 6 Years; Programme Fee: Rs. 6,000
Eligibility:
(a). 10+2 or its equivalent;
(b). Registration in Company Secretaryship Foundation Programme; and
(c). Exclusively for ICSI Students only
3). B.Com. with Major in Financial and Cost Accounting: B.Com. (F&CA)
Exclusively for the ICWAI students only
This Programme is designed and developed in collaboration with The Institute of Cost and Works
Accountants of India (ICWAI), exclusively for the ICWAI students, who can simultaneously study this
programme with ICWAI Foundation/Intermediate course offered by ICWAI.
Minimum Duration: 3 Years Maximum Duration: 6 Years Programme Fee: Rs. 6,000
Eligibility:
(a). 10+2 or its equivalent;
(b). Registration in ICWAI Foundation Course; and
(c). Exclusively for ICWAI Students only
